2020 Audi Q3 premium compact SUV expected to launch in India

Audi is planning on with its launch of the 2020 Q3 premium compact SUV in March 2020 in India. 2020 Audi Q3 is one of the vehicles mentioned in the previous Audi’s 130th Annual General Meeting. This luxury SUV is going to get a “Sportback” treatment and becoming one of the new SUV variants. It was expected to have a BS-6 Complaint engine.

Q3 has soft flowing lines which gives it a sharper and sportier looks. The front-end of Audi Q3 comes with Audi’s trademark vertical slat grille that are flanked by LED headlamps. Despite the transformation of it the premium SUV can still be recognized as a Q3. Where as at the side of the new 2020 Q3 looks similar to the existing model and also comes with a shoulder line flowing cleanly through the profile it also has a faux air dams that gives it a sportier looks.

Q3 SUV is powered by 2.0 – litre TSI engine that generates out 190 PS of power and 320 Nm of torque. It is expected to offer a 7-speed dual-clutch transmission and also it might come with Audi’s quattro ADS systems (All-wheel-drive). Audi’s plans on to go with a petrol-only which might be a disadvantage, As Mercedes-Benz and BMW are steadily updating their diesel models to meet the BS6 emission norms.

Audi Q3 SUV has a new 10 spoke alloy wheels which complement its overall style. The rear has a new tailgate with a sharply raked windscreen and LED tail lamps. 

Audi Q3 SUV is euipped with a latest dashboard design as seen in more modern Audis. It also has a 10.1-inch MMI infotainment system and Virtual Cockpit, besides that it include connected car technology, Android Auto and Apple CarPlay, a panoramic sunroof, dual-zone climate control, ambient lighting, cruise control as well as powered front seats. With the safety systems it has included a adaptive cruise control, traffic jam assist and active lane assist which will be offered in the UK-spec model.
